WebWe call them structural isomers because they have a different pattern of covalent bonding. In butane all the carbons form a single chain, but the carbons in isobutene form a branched chain. Stereoisomers. Stereoisomers have the same number of atoms and bonds, but they differ in how their atoms are oriented around one or mor carbons. WebBy converting these hydrocarbons into branched-chain isomers, the resulting gasoline blendstock has a higher octane rating and can be used in high-performance engines without causing knocking. Isomerization is a key process in the production of reformulated gasoline, which is required by environmental regulations in many countries.

WebJan 5, 2016 · Branched and cycled hydrocarbons usually a higher octane number than their straight chain counterparts. This is due to a more complete and clean (no residue) combustion. In addition, there is no probability of knocking or detonation. WebBranched-chain isomers. WebNov 15, 2013 · Consequently, the boiling points of the branched chain alkanes are less than the straight chain isomers. The above extract from my book, mentions clearly that branching makes the molecule more compact and thereby decreases the surface area.
